Google has unveiled a new AI-powered tool called "Me Meme," allowing you to create personalized memes using your own photos. This exciting addition, first spotted by Android Authority last October, was officially announced by Google on Thursday, offering a fun twist to your photo editing experience.

But here's where it gets controversial... Google admits that the feature is still experimental, so don't expect perfect results just yet. They recommend using well-lit, focused, and front-facing photos for the best outcomes. It's all about exploring and experimenting with Google's Gemini AI technology, specifically the Nano Banana model, which powers other creative AI features in the Google Photos app.

However, the feature is not yet fully rolled out, so you might not see it in your updated Google Photos app immediately. Google assures us it will be available under the "Create" tab soon, with a rollout to U.S. iOS and Android users expected over the coming weeks.

To use "Me Meme," simply select a template or upload your own, tap "add photo" and "Generate." Google promises to add more templates over time, so the possibilities are endless. After the AI creates your meme, you can save, share, or even "regenerate" it for a fresh take.
